Prospective homebuyers seeking a residential property in the national capital have received a significant festive opportunity, as the Delhi Development Authority has introduced 544 additional ready-to-move-in apartments under its Karmajeevi Awaas Yojana 2026. Rolled out on the occasion of Ganesh Chaturthi, the housing initiative features a direct 25 percent price discount across the newly added units. The housing body specifically structured this scheme to assist government employees, corporate sector working professionals, and self-employed individuals in securing immediate possession of quality housing within Delhi.
The residential scheme has witnessed robust market demand since its initial launch. Official details indicate that over 60 percent of the total flat inventory offered under the project was booked within just one month of opening applications. Encouraged by this strong buyer response, the authority decided to expand the available supply by bringing an extra batch of completed units into the scheme ahead of the upcoming festival season.
Breakdown of 1BHK and 2BHK Units in Narela
The newly included batch of 544 extra apartments comprises two distinct layout options tailored for varying family sizes and budgets. Out of the total inventory, 256 units are categorized as 1BHK apartments, while the remaining 288 units are 2BHK flats. All these residences are completely finished and ready for instant occupancy upon allocation. The properties are situated in Narela at Pocket 11, Sector A1-A4, offering fully constructed infrastructure ready for immediate move-in.
Location Advantages and Regional Infrastructure
The Pocket 11 residential cluster in Narela is positioned within a serene, green neighborhood designed to offer a healthy living environment. Beyond its eco-friendly surroundings, the location boasts proximity to several critical transit corridors and civic infrastructure projects currently serving or planned for North West Delhi.
In terms of distance metrics, the housing site is located just 500 meters away from Urban Extension Road 1 (UER-1) and sits merely 1.1 km from the major GT Karnal Road. Public transit access will be further enhanced by a proposed metro station situated just 1.2 km from the residential pocket. For sports and recreational activities, the Narela Sports Complex lies within a 2 km radius, while an upcoming educational hub is being established at a distance of 5 km.
First-Come, First-Served Booking Timeline
Online bookings for the additional 544 ready-to-move flats are scheduled to open on September 14, 2026, starting at 12:00 PM. The housing agency has emphasized that unit allocations will proceed strictly on a first-come, first-served basis. Consequently, buyers who complete their digital application and booking formalities earliest will be granted priority in securing their preferred apartment.
Step-by-Step Application Process and Portals
Interested applicants can participate in the booking window by accessing the official website of the authority at dda.gov.in. Alternatively, homebuyers can register and select their units through the dedicated e-services portal at eservices.dda.org.in.
